Interpol个人资料
Interpol is an alternative rock band from New York City. Popular songs include Evil, PDA and NYC. The band's current members are Paul Banks, Daniel Kessler, and Sam Fogarino. Bassist Carlos Dengler departed the band in 2010.

Origins
The group was founded in 1998 . Daniel Kessler (guitar) met Carlos Dengler at the New York University and convinced Carlos to play with him and Greg Drudy (drummer). Kessler had Paul Banks (vocals) met several years earlier in 1996when she together in Paris were at Summer School. When the two bumped into each other in New York, Kessler remembered that Banks played guitar, and he invited him to come to the group. In 2000, Greg Drudy left the group and came to Samuel Fogarino drumming in his place
After the fourth album Dengler left the group. This was on May 9, 2010 announced on the official website: "Carlos wants to walk different paths, this is a friendly farewell, and we wish him all the best with his future projects, we will always be a fan of this very talented individual..."
Group
The band played at the beginning without group. Only when she started to get some adherence was decided on a name. Many different stories about it.
Singer Paul Banks was sometimes called laughing through his Spanish friends Pol Pol Interpol.
The name could refer to the style and method of the band, which would be similar to those of the International Police ie Interpol .
In any case, the band Interpol was baptized and not "Las Armas" or "The French Letters", two other options. The result of that name was that she regularly emails were sent from people who thought they were the real Interpol. Early, via their website Paul Banks also said once in an interview that he once after a concert in Brussels was approached by someone who worked for Interpol and had come to look out of curiosity.
Albums
EP's (1998 - 2002)
Before Interpol released his first album, the band already had a number of EPs made. The FukD 'ID # 3 was published by Chemical Underground, a British indie rock record. In the same year appeared the Precipitate EP 's, which were issued by the band. itself In June 2002, the published Interpol EP , as a prelude to the album Turn on the Bright Lights .
Turn on the Bright Lights (2002)
Matador, a record from New York, gave Interpol the opportunity to participate. Her first studio album Turn on the Bright Lights , the debut album that owes its name to a line from the song "NYC", brought the band great fame in theunderground rock scene . The obscure nature and attractive but quirky riffs delivered Interpol fans in both the United States and Europe, but also in countries like Japan. In 2003 appeared an EP with some live recordings made during the Black Sessions for the French radio station France Inter. This ep was titled The Black EP .

Antics (2004)
After the successful debut album followed Antics , which, like Turn on the Bright Lights was released by Matador. Interpol released his second album a slightly different character than the debut album. Antics is not as dark as its predecessor and also something more sophisticated. In general, Antics be seen as a slightly more accessible album than Turn on the Bright Lights. Also sound Banks' vocals a lot cleaner. On Turn on the Bright Lights he used many effects on his singing because he felt insecure as a singer. The singles "Slow Hands", "Evil" and "C'mere" were also quite successful. If B-sides include some remixes were used. In 2005 Matador bundled four remixes that were created by the band and released it as the Remix EP . The song "Narc" was also a single, although it was a radio single .

Band members
Current band members
Paul Banks - singer, guitarist
Samuel Fogarino - drums (since 2000)
Daniel Kessler - guitarist
Former band members
Greg Drudy - drums (1997-2000)
Carlos Dengler (Carlos D.) - bass (1998-2010)
